PR Visa Options for Engineering Technologists ✈️ 1. Skilled Independent Visa Applicants who apply for the Skilled Independent Visa (Subclass 189) do not need employer sponsorship because this points-based visa does not require it. Industrials who fulfil points requirements can select the Skilled Independent Visa (Subclass 189) for residence in any Australian area. Eligibility Criteria The Migration Regulations require your status as Engineering Technologist (ANZSCO Code: 233914) to belong to the MLTSSL. Engineers Australia needs to provide you with a positive skill assessment. Residents must achieve at least 65 points according to the points test requirements. The applicant must be younger than 45. A candidate needs to demonstrate sufficient English language proficiency through IELTS, PTE, or equivalent exams. 2. Skilled Nominated Visa To obtain the skilled nominated visa (Subclass 190), candidates need to receive state or territory nominations in addition to meeting the requirements of Subclass 189. Eligibility Criteria To obtain this visa, you need state nomination on top of the requirements for Subclass 189. New South Wales (NSW), along with Victoria and Queensland state departments, often issue invitations to engineering technologists. Benefits Additional 5 points for state nomination. The processing period for Subclass 190 is shorter than it is for Subclass 189. 3. Skilled Work Regional (Provisional) Visa Success on the Subclass 491 visa is reserved for skilled individuals who accept employment while living in Australia&#8217;s regional areas. The Subclass 191 visa for PR stands as an option after spending three years with this visa. Eligibility Criteria Same as the Subclass 190 visa requires regional nomination as a requirement. Offers 15 additional points. The visa applicant must settle in a specified regional area of Australia, along with working there. Benefits The opportunity to obtain an invitation increases because there are fewer candidates ready to apply. Leads to PR after three years of regional work. Eligibility Requirements for Engineering Technologist Immigration  Organisations authorised by Engineers Australia must assess applicants&#8217; skills before they can qualify to migrate as engineering technologists. The migrants must also reach the required points total and present sufficient English skills. a. Skills Assessment by Engineers Australia Engineering technologists need Engineers Australia to conduct their Competency Demonstration Report (CDR)-based assessment of skills. CDR Report Requirements Every career episode requires different engineering experiences as part of the assessment. The document demonstrates Australia&#8217;s competency standards regarding professional abilities. The Continuing Professional Development (CPD) requires Engineers Australia members to maintain a record of their ongoing engineering-related learning activities. The evaluation process at Engineers Australia uses the Australian and New Zealand Standard Classification of Occupations (ANZSCO) Code 233914 for Engineering Technologist assessment. b. Points-Based Immigration System The minimum points requirement for Subclass 189, 190, and 491 visas generally requires applicants to score at least 65 points through evaluation of the following factors: Age (25-32 years) English Proficiency Work Experience Australian Education State Nomination Regional Nomination c.
